Diverticulum of the cecum and its treatment

click fraud protection

A typical place of development of the true diverticulum of the congenital type is the cecum. Pathological protrusions, appearing here, are only single and develop from all three layers of the walls of the digestive organ. With the inflammation of these pathological protrusions, patients have severe pain in the lower abdomen, reminiscent of the clinic of an acute appendix. They are especially palpable. Diverticulum of the cecum is usually perforated as an appendix. Differentiate the inflammation of the pathological protrusion and acute appendicitis, it is possible only during surgical intervention. This pathology accounts for about 3% of cases.

An inflamed sacciform protrusion located in this part of the digestive organs compresses them, causing obstruction. With a chronic diverticulitis of the cecum, symptoms such as painful sensations of an indeterminate nature, constipation and bloody inclusions in the stool are observed. The leading role in the diagnosis of pathology is played by colonoscopy and irrigoscopy, but for the most part diverticula are an accidental finding.

Patients at risk for developing this ailment are usually interested in how the cervical diverticulum is treated. Therapy of this disease is conservative even in the case of chronic complications. All medical measures in this disease consist of prescriptions of sedative, anti-inflammatory and antispasmodic drugs, as well as physiotherapy. All therapeutic actions should take place against a background of a special diet. Also, with the diverticulosis of the cecum, it must be emphasized that the patient is necessarily assigned to bed rest, which helps reduce intestinal pressure.

In case of diverticulosis of the caecum, complicated by bleeding, in addition to bed rest, a two-day fasting is shown, and treatment is carried out with the help of medications chosen by a specialist. After the bleeding completely stopped, you need to observe a sparing diet for 2-3 days, and then switch to food rich in vegetable fiber. Patients at risk should take preventive measures to avoid the occurrence of this pathology. They are in the conduct of an active lifestyle, the rejection of bad habits and the use of a large amount of fiber.
